Soft sediment tends to make shaking in an earthquake worse. It is rather like shaking a bowl of jello.

How many times greater is the maximum ground motion of a magnitude 5 earthquake compared with that of a magnitude 3 earthquake?

The ground motion of a magnitude 5 earthquake is 100 times greater than that of a magnitude 3 earthquake. This is because each whole number increase in magnitude represents an increase in amplitude by a factor of 10.

How many times greater is the maximum ground motion of a magnitude 4 earthquake compared with that of a magnitude 2 earthquake?

The ground motion of a magnitude 4 earthquake is 100 times greater than that of a magnitude 2 earthquake. This is because each whole number increase in magnitude represents a tenfold increase in amplitude and a 32-fold increase in energy release.
